Frequently asked questions

What is the name of Gillies Bay's airport?
Gillies Bay has only one airport, Powell River Airport (YPW).
How far is YPW from central Gillies Bay?
YPW is 18 kilometers from downtown Gillies Bay, so you'll have a bit of a commute into the heart of the city.

Which airlines fly to Gillies Bay?
Flights to Gillies Bay are typically operated by Pacific Coastal Airlines. The highest number of these flights take off from Vancouver, with Pacific Coastal Airlines servicing this route the most often.
How many nonstop flights are there to Gillies Bay?
With roughly 19 direct flights running each week, you'll be hitting the runway in Gillies Bay before you can say, "Are we there yet?"
Where are the most popular flights to Gillies Bay departing from?
Flights departing from Vancouver to Gillies Bay generally get booked the fastest.
How long is the flight to Gillies Bay Airport?
Flying time from Vancouver to Gillies Bay is approximately 38 minutes, so settle back, relax and enjoy the in-flight entertainment.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Gillies Bay?
The answer is simple — be prepared. We've compiled some tips and tricks for an easy trip through airport security. Watch out Gillies Bay, here you come:

  • Your passport and boarding pass will need to be shown to security personnel. Keep them at hand so you don't hold up the line.
  • Next up, both you and your carry-on luggage must be X-rayed. To speed things up, take off anything that is likely to trigger the alarm. Items like your coat, belt and headphones will be required to go through the machine.
  • All your electronic devices, including your phone and laptop, must also be scanned separately.
  • Any liquids or gels, such as perfume or hand cream, that you want to take on board need to be in containers no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). Also, everything must fit inside a quart-size (one liter), clear zip-close bag.
  • It's also likely that you'll need to take your shoes off to be X-rayed, so wearing slip-on shoes is always a wise idea.
  • Airlines will not allow any pocket knives or other sharp items in the cabin. If you need to bring these kinds of items, pack them safely in your checked luggage.
